DROPBOX
When you use Dropbox, you’ll have access to your photos, videos, and documents — on your HTC
phone, your computer, and your other mobile phones where you have Dropbox access.
On your HTC phone, sign in to your Dropbox account so you can:
n Enjoy an additional 23GB of free Dropbox storage for two years. Additional terms and
requirements may apply (including a subscription fee) after your two year trial ends.
n Access your photos and videos that are stored in Dropbox right from Gallery.
n No more large attachments when sharing by email. Simply send a link to your Dropbox files.
n View and edit Office documents that are stored in Dropbox.
n View PDFs that are stored in Dropbox.
n Save documents, such as from email attachments, directly to Dropbox.
n Check your remaining Dropbox storage space anytime.
About the Additional Free Dropbox Storage Offer
The additional 23GB Dropbox storage is a special offer that’s available on your phone and other
HTC phones using Android™ with HTC Sense
®
4.0 or later. This offer is available to both new and
current Dropbox users.
n To get the additional 23GB of Dropbox storage free for two years, please sign in to your Dropbox
account from your HTC phone (and not from your computer or other non-HTC phones), and
complete the getting started guide on the Dropbox website (dropbox.com/gs).
n If you don’t have a Dropbox account yet, you can create a new account from your phone or from
your computer at dropbox.com.
n This additional free storage is a one-time offer only. You’re eligible to use this offer only on one HTC
phone.
